SCRIPTURE: Psalm 25:1-22

OBSERVATION:
David is asking the Lord to support him against those who are persecuting him, he asks the Lord to keep him from being shamed.
Pleads for God’s help so that he will respond appropriately to his attackers, with integrity (v.21).
He also acknowledges that he is a sinner, and therefore doesn’t deserve God’s help
Asks on the basis of God’s character (vv.6-11), not his own worthiness (v.7).
David is very honest about his struggle, but he reminds himself through this prayer of God’s power, love and mercy.
Finishes with an appeal to God to rescue His covenant people from all troubles (v.22).

APPLICATION:
Often we respond to tough times by questioning God’s goodness or love; David reaffirms God’s goodness and love through his crisis.
Pride leads many to question God in tough times, but a humble spirit admits their weakness and pleads for mercy and help.
We have lost our sense of God’s holy goodness, we are like spoiled brats who don’t get our way and yell at our servant for not getting us what we want.
This Psalm shows the kind of spirit we need to have when we go through tough times.
